A Quote by Martin Luther King, Jr. on divinity, life, mercy, spirit, and weakness
The spirit of Lincoln still lives; that spirit born of the teachings of the Nazarene, who promised mercy to the merciful, who lifted the lowly, strengthened the weak, ate with publicans, and made the captives free. In the light of this divine example, the doctrines of demagogues shiver in their chaff.
Source: The Negro and the Constitution (in The Cornellian, May 1944)
